Hiking Trail Conditions Report
Peaks
Peaks Mt. Monadnock, NH
Trails
Trails: White Cross Trail, White Dot Trail, Pumpelly Trail, Cascade Link Trail
Date of Hike
Date of Hike: Friday, November 23, 2018
Parking/Access Road Notes
Parking/Access Road Notes:  
Surface Conditions
Surface Conditions: Snow - Packed Powder/Loose Granular, Snow - Unpacked Powder, Standing/Running Water on Trail, Snow/Ice - Frozen Granular, Snow - Drifts 
Recommended Equipment
Recommended Equipment: Light Traction 
Water Crossing Notes
Water Crossing Notes: Small streams - easy to cross 
Trail Maintenance Notes
Trail Maintenance Notes: Cascade link trail could use more blazes in the section nearest the Pumpelly Trail 
Dog-Related Notes
Dog-Related Notes:  
Bugs
Bugs:  
Lost and Found
Lost and Found:  
 
Comments
Comments: A little chilly at the start with no wind. Breezy on the summit. Broke out Cascade Link Trail - all other trails broken out. Enjoyed this hike with 7 REI staff and 3 others.
